管理 API 密钥

IMPORTANT
Workfront不再建议使用/login端点或API密钥。 请改用以下身份验证方法之一:
  • 使用JWT进行服务器身份验证
  • 使用OAuth2进行用户身份验证
有关设置这些身份验证方法的说明,请参阅为Workfront集成创建OAuth2应用程序
有关在Workfront中使用服务器身份验证的说明,请参阅使用JWT流配置和使用您组织的自定义OAuth 2应用程序
有关在Workfront中使用用户身份验证的说明,请参阅使用授权代码流配置和使用您组织的自定义OAuth 2应用程序

为了最大程度地降低API安全漏洞,Adobe Workfront管理员可以管理用于使应用程序能够代表用户访问Workfront的API密钥。

您可以重置或删除当前管理员API密钥,将API密钥配置为过期,以及删除所有用户的API密钥。

以下是利用Workfront API的应用程序示例:

  • 记录集成,例如Dropbox、Google Drive和Workfront DAM
  • Workfront移动应用程序
IMPORTANT
重置或删除API密钥时,必须重新配置任何利用Workfront API并通过此API密钥向Workfront进行身份验证的应用程序,才能重新获得对Workfront的访问权限。

访问权限要求

展开可查看本文所述功能的访问权限要求。
table 0-row-2 1-row-2 2-row-2 layout-auto html-authored no-header
Adobe Workfront 包 “任一”
Adobe Workfront许可证

标准

规划

访问级别配置 您必须是Workfront管理员。

有关信息,请参阅Workfront文档中的访问要求

Workfront API密钥

Workfront中的每个用户都有一个唯一的API密钥。 当用户访问利用Workfront API的集成(例如Workfront移动应用程序或文档集成)时,将生成此密钥。

NOTE
在每周刷新期间,您在生产环境中生成的API密钥将会复制到预览环境中。 在每周刷新期间,您在“预览”环境中生成的任何API密钥都将由生产API密钥覆盖。

Workfront管理员还有唯一的API密钥。 当应用程序使用管理员API密钥访问Workfront时,该应用程序具有Workfront的管理员访问权限。

管理管理员API密钥

您可以为管理员用户帐户生成、重置或删除API密钥。

  1. 单击Adobe Workfront左上角的​ 主菜单 ​图标 主菜单 ,然后单击​设置 设置图标

  2. 单击​系统> 客户信息。

  3. (视情况而定)执行以下操作之一:

    要生成API密钥:在​ API密钥设置 ​部分中,单击​生成API密钥


    要重置API密钥:在​ API密钥设置 ​部分中,单击​重置,然后单击​重置。

    要删除API密钥:在​ API密钥设置 ​部分中,单击​删除,然后单击​删除

配置API密钥过期时间

您可以将API密钥配置为对系统中的所有用户过期。 当用户的API密钥过期时,用户必须向使用Workfront API访问Workfront的任何应用程序重新进行身份验证。 您可以更改API密钥的过期频率。 您还可以配置API密钥在用户密码过期时是否过期。

  1. 单击Adobe Workfront左上角的​ 主菜单 ​图标 主菜单 ,然后单击​设置 设置图标

  2. 单击​系统 > 客户信息

  3. 在​ API密钥设置 ​区域的​ 创建 ​后​ API密钥在 ​下拉列表中过期,请选择希望API密钥过期的时间范围。

    更改此选项时,新时间范围从您进行更改时开始。 例如,如果您将此选项从​ 1个月 ​更改为​6个月,则API密钥将在您进行更改后6个月过期。

    默认情况下,API密钥每月过期。

  4. 若要将API密钥配置为在用户密码过期时过期,请启用​在用户密码过期时删除API密钥

    默认情况下,不启用此选项。

    有关如何配置用户密码过期的信息,请参阅配置系统安全首选项

  5. 单击​保存

删除所有用户的API密钥

如果您担心您的Workfront系统存在特定的安全漏洞,则可以同时为所有用户删除API密钥。

IMPORTANT
删除所有用户的API密钥将导致系统中所有用户的所有API密钥失效。 此操作将导致Workfront中的所有集成失败,直到您在Workfront中生成新的API密钥并更新所有集成为止。
  1. 单击Adobe Workfront左上角的​ 主菜单 ​图标 主菜单 ,然后单击​设置 设置图标

  2. 展开​系统,然后单击​客户信息

  3. 在​ API密钥设置 ​区域中,单击​删除所有API密钥,然后单击​ 删除全部

recommendation-more-help
5f00cc6b-2202-40d6-bcd0-3ee0c2316b43